What will be the 7-day moving average of ship transits through the Strait of Hormuz for the week of June 29 to July 5, 2026?

  • My most likely prediction for the 7-day moving average of ship transits through the Strait of Hormuz for the week of June 29 to July 5, 2026, is 29.50, with a 50% chance of falling between 24.50 and 34.50.
  • Current shipping traffic is in a recovery phase following a major regional conflict that began in February 2026; while peacetime levels averaged 93–125 transits daily, volumes were in the single digits as recently as mid-June.
  • A significant late-June rebound saw daily transits reach 70–78 on June 24, though fresh security incidents on June 25 and 27 moderated this surge to approximately 30–40 ships per day.
  • A cessation of hostilities announced on June 28, 2026, combined with high-level negotiations in Qatar, supports a partial normalization of traffic during the forecast window.
  • External prediction markets strongly favor a 7-day moving average between 20 and 40 (83% probability), reflecting a consensus that traffic will be significantly higher than the June baseline but far below the pre-war norm.
  • Key constraints to a full recovery include the necessity of mine-clearing operations, the continued “dark” operation of vessels (AIS spoofing), and the cautious stance of maritime insurers.

Historical context

  • The Strait of Hormuz typically handles 20% of global oil and gas exports, with a pre-crisis baseline of ~93-125 daily transits.
  • Following the start of the conflict on February 28, 2026, transits dropped by approximately 70% almost immediately, reaching near-zero levels by early March.
  • During the “Tanker War” of the 1980s, shipping continued under naval escort; the 2026 crisis has seen a similar shift toward escorted convoys and specific nation exemptions (China, Russia, India).
  • On June 14, 2026, a US-Iran MoU initially triggered a brief transit increase that was quickly reversed by a re-closure on June 20, demonstrating the extreme volatility of diplomatic signals in this region.
  • The IMF PortWatch platform was launched in November 2023 specifically to track such maritime disruptions using satellite-based big data analytics.

Detailed reasoning

My analysis of the forecast for ship transits through the Strait of Hormuz for the week of June 29 to July 5, 2026, is based on a synthesis of recent historical data, real-time maritime tracking reports, and external market signals.

Historically, the Strait of Hormuz is a stable chokepoint with a pre-crisis median of 93–125 daily transits. However, the conflict starting February 28, 2026, fundamentally altered this regime. Data from the IMF PortWatch platform—the authoritative source for this forecast—showed daily totals collapsing to near zero in March and remaining severely depressed. As recently as June 21, 2026, PortWatch reported only 5 transits, with a 7-day moving average of 13.14.

Despite this depressed baseline, multiple high-frequency indicators from late June suggest a significant “release of pent-up demand.” Third-party trackers like Kpler and S&P Global reported a spike to 78 transits on June 24. Although subsequent attacks on the vessels Ever Lovely (June 25) and M/T Kiku (June 27) caused a temporary retrenchment to the 30–40 transit range, the announcement of a cessation of hostilities on June 28, 2026, provides a strong tailwind for the forecast week.

I have weighted the Polymarket data heavily, as it specifically targets the IMF PortWatch resolution. The market indicates an 83% probability that the 7-day moving average will fall between 20 and 40. This range is logically consistent with a scenario where shipping begins to normalize under a ceasefire but is still hampered by “dark” AIS activity, the withdrawal of P&I insurance, and the need for mine clearance.

My predicted most likely value of 29.50 reflects a daily transit regime that is roughly triple the June baseline but still less than one-third of peacetime levels. This account for the fact that IMF PortWatch often records lower counts than other trackers during periods of AIS spoofing or deactivation, which remains a reported issue in the region. The 50% HDI of 24.50 to 34.50 captures the expected stabilization of traffic as negotiations begin in Doha, while the broader 80% interval allows for the possibility of a faster “peace dividend” recovery (up to 40+) or a reporting-lag-driven lower average (down to 18.50).

Historical and Geopolitical Context Prior to the early-2026 conflict, Strait of Hormuz traffic averaged roughly 100 or more daily transits. Since the onset of hostilities, this baseline has collapsed, routinely dropping to the low single digits. A fragile mid-June ceasefire prompted a brief surge as vessels attempted to clear a massive backlog, but renewed drone and missile strikes over the late-June weekend quickly shattered this recovery. While a fresh “stand-down” and emergency diplomatic talks in Doha offer a potential path to de-escalation, severe risk aversion, suspended international naval escorts, and skyrocketing war-risk insurance premiums are expected to heavily suppress commercial movement during the target week.

Methodological Limitations of IMF PortWatch A crucial driver of the forecast is the resolution metric’s reliance on IMF PortWatch, which tracks vessels exclusively via Automatic Identification System (AIS) satellite signals. Due to the high-threat environment, active military targeting, and GPS spoofing, a substantial portion of vessels are navigating “dark” with their transponders intentionally turned off. Consequently, even if physical traffic begins to flow, PortWatch will systematically and severely undercount the actual number of transits.

Structural and Logistical Constraints Even in optimistic scenarios where the ceasefire holds and the massive backlog of trapped vessels begins to move, daily traffic faces hard physical ceilings. Bottlenecks such as uncleared sea mines, the strict necessity for single-file military escorts, and challenging monsoon weather patterns in the Arabian Sea will limit the maximum capacity of the Strait. Furthermore, historical maritime recoveries show that shipowners resume operations in a delayed, gradual trickle rather than an immediate surge. Because the target week begins with deeply depressed transit numbers following the late-June escalation, the resulting 7-day average will be mathematically anchored to these lows, reflecting a highly cautious and mechanically constrained operational environment.

Research Rundown: Strait of Hormuz Ship Transits (June 29 - July 5, 2026)

Current Context (as of June 29, 2026)

You’re forecasting during an extremely volatile period. A US-Iran conflict that began February 28, 2026 (“Operation Epic Fury”) effectively closed the Strait of Hormuz for months. A peace memorandum was signed June 14-15, 2026, but the recovery has been fragile and marked by renewed violence in the past week [1][7][9].

Critical Recent Developments

Last 48-72 Hours (June 26-29):

  • Traffic has sharply declined after reaching a post-war peak of 62-78 ships on June 24 [8][18][19]
  • The container ship Ever Lovely was struck June 24, followed by the Kiku tanker June 26, triggering renewed US strikes on Iran [5][8][10]
  • By June 27-28, daily transits dropped to 24 and then 12 ships respectively [9]
  • As of June 29, traffic sits near 13 ships/day—about 90% below pre-war levels [9]
  • Kpler reports 124 cargo ships transited from Thursday to Monday (June 26-29), averaging ~31 ships/day [24]

Competing Navigation Regimes: The strait now operates as a “confused, two-tier system” [9]:

  • Iranian-controlled northern route
  • US/Oman-protected southern route
  • Pre-war routes remain mined and unusable

Historical Base Rates & Reference Classes

Pre-Conflict Baseline (2025 - February 2026)
  • 100-138 ships per day [1][4][11][13]
  • Approximately 50-60% were oil/LNG tankers [13]
  • Handled 20-25% of global maritime oil trade [13][15]
  • 20.9 million barrels/day of petroleum products in first half of 2025 [15]
During Conflict (March 1 - June 14, 2026)
  • <10 ships per day average [4][13][17][21]
  • Lowest points: 1-7 ships on individual days in June [1]
  • March 10-11: Only 2-7 ships per day [11]
  • April 23-29: Just 24 transits for entire week [12]
  • 93.6% of vessels avoided official IMO channels [24]
Initial Recovery Phase (June 15-24, 2026)
  • June 15-24 average: 22 ships/day (Kpler) [17][21][22]
  • June 20-25 average: 38.2 ships/day (AXSMarine) [19]
  • Progressive daily counts:
  • June 15: 3 ships [1]
  • June 18: 24-26 ships [2][7]
  • June 22: 37-38 ships (highest since war began) [4][17]
  • June 23: 36 ships [23]
  • June 24: 62 ships (AXSMarine) / 78 ships (S&P Global) - peak day [8][18][19]
Post-Attack Decline (June 24-29, 2026)
  • Current: ~13-31 ships/day [9][24]
  • Sharp volatility: 58 → 24 → 12 ships over three days [9]
